COLUMBUS – Columbus State University softball is set for a Tuesday afternoon doubleheader against Shorter (Ga.) at Cougar Field.

Columbus State welcomes Shorter to Cougar Field on Tuesday for a 3 p.m. ET doubleheader after coming off a two-game sweep of Albany State (Ga.) a week ago. As for the Hawks, they are riding a two-game winning streak after opening the season with eight-straight losses.
The Lady Cougars are 7-1 on the season and 8-2 all-time versus the foes from Rome, Georgia. Last season, CSU traveled to Rome and took home 14-4 and 6-3 victories back on Feb. 27, 2024.
So far this season, CSU is batting .304 as a squad with 58 hits and 49 runs scored. Out of the 49 hits, 18 have been extra-base hits. Gracyn Gurley and Nova Wright lead the team with three doubles each while Wright has a home run under her belt. Gurley is batting .385 while Wright is batting .381. The two have combined for 16 RBIs, 13 hits, and 11 runs.
In the circle, Julianna Franklin and reigning PBC Freshman of the week Lily Miller record most of the innings. Franklin has tossed for 29.2 innings this season, notching a 1.18 ERA and a total of 32 strikeouts. As for Miller, she has a 1.50 ERA on 14.0 innings pitched and 12 strikeouts.
